#380279 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#380279 is composed of 22% red, 0.8%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.7% cyan, 98.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 267.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 24.1%. #380279 color hex could be obtained by blending #7004f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#380279 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#380279 has RGB values of R:56, G:2,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3670649.

Hex triplet 380279 #380279
RGB Decimal 56, 2, 121 rgb(56,2,121)
RGB Percent 22, 0.8, 47.5 rgb(22%,0.8%,47.5%)
CMYK 54, 98, 0, 53
HSL 267.2°, 96.7, 24.1 hsl(267.2,96.7%,24.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 267.2°, 98.3, 47.5
Web Safe 330066 #330066
CIE-LAB 16.819, 47.167, -53.701
XYZ 5.103, 2.265, 18.256
xyY 0.199, 0.088, 2.265
CIE-LCH 16.819, 71.474, 311.294
CIE-LUV 16.819, 4.304, -54.911
Hunter-Lab 15.049, 34.197, -61.394
Binary 00111000, 00000010, 01111001

Shades and Tints of #380279

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020005 is the darkest color, while #f7f1ff is the lightest one.
